Default Gas smell, low milage.

I have a 1995 850 turbo sedan, every once and awhile when driving it within like 30 minutes of turning it on, it smells like gas, I figured maybe it was just needing to warm up so it was running rich. Then I noticed I'm getting 14 mpg, again, seemed low but I have a lead foot. I checked my fuel lines and they appeared "wet" however I wiped some of the wetness off with a paper towel and it was black, and did not smell like gas.

Basically what I'm asking is if you guys think my fuel lines are leaking because of the smell/low mpg, or if its normal. thanks.

Could be a leaking fuel line or even a bad injector seal that is leaking. I would check the fuel pressure and all the lines. When you check the fuel pressure, make sure that the pressure does not drop when the car is turned off.
